| package com.android.systemui.statusbar.policy; |
| |
| import android.app.ActivityManager; |
| import android.content.Context; |
| import android.content.Intent; |
| import android.net.wifi.WifiManager.ActionListener; |
| import android.os.Looper; |
| import android.os.UserHandle; |
| import android.os.UserManager; |
| import android.provider.Settings; |
| import android.util.Log; |
| |
| import com.android.settingslib.wifi.AccessPoint; |
| import com.android.settingslib.wifi.WifiTracker; |
| import com.android.settingslib.wifi.WifiTracker.WifiListener; |
| import com.android.systemui.R; |
| |
| import java.io.PrintWriter; |
| import java.util.ArrayList; |
| import java.util.List; |
| |
| public class AccessPointControllerImpl |
| implements NetworkController.AccessPointController, WifiListener { |
| private static final String TAG = "AccessPointController"; |
| private static final boolean DEBUG = Log.isLoggable(TAG, Log.DEBUG); |
| |
| // This string extra specifies a network to open the connect dialog on, so the user can enter |
| // network credentials. This is used by quick settings for secured networks. |
| private static final String EXTRA_START_CONNECT_SSID = "wifi_start_connect_ssid"; |
| |
| private static final int[] ICONS = { |
| R.drawable.ic_qs_wifi_full_0, |
| R.drawable.ic_qs_wifi_full_1, |
| R.drawable.ic_qs_wifi_full_2, |
| R.drawable.ic_qs_wifi_full_3, |
| R.drawable.ic_qs_wifi_full_4, |
| }; |
| |
| private final Context mContext; |
| private final ArrayList<AccessPointCallback> mCallbacks = new ArrayList<AccessPointCallback>(); |
| private final WifiTracker mWifiTracker; |
| private final UserManager mUserManager; |
| |
| private int mCurrentUser; |
| |
| public AccessPointControllerImpl(Context context, Looper bgLooper) { |
| mContext = context; |
| mUserManager = (UserManager) mContext.getSystemService(Context.USER_SERVICE); |
| mWifiTracker = new WifiTracker(context, this, bgLooper, false, true); |
| mCurrentUser = ActivityManager.getCurrentUser(); |
| } |
| |
| public boolean canConfigWifi() { |
| return !mUserManager.hasUserRestriction(UserManager.DISALLOW_CONFIG_WIFI, |
| new UserHandle(mCurrentUser)); |
| } |
| |
| public void onUserSwitched(int newUserId) { |
| mCurrentUser = newUserId; |
| } |
| |
| @Override |
| public void addAccessPointCallback(AccessPointCallback callback) { |
| if (callback == null || mCallbacks.contains(callback)) return; |
| if (DEBUG) Log.d(TAG, "addCallback " + callback); |
| mCallbacks.add(callback); |
| if (mCallbacks.size() == 1) { |
| mWifiTracker.startTracking(); |
| } |
| } |
| |
| @Override |
| public void removeAccessPointCallback(AccessPointCallback callback) { |
| if (callback == null) return; |
| if (DEBUG) Log.d(TAG, "removeCallback " + callback); |
| mCallbacks.remove(callback); |
| if (mCallbacks.isEmpty()) { |
| mWifiTracker.stopTracking(); |
| } |
| } |
| |
| @Override |
| public void scanForAccessPoints() { |
| if (DEBUG) Log.d(TAG, "force update APs!"); |
| mWifiTracker.forceUpdate(); |
| fireAcccessPointsCallback(mWifiTracker.getAccessPoints()); |
| } |
| |
| @Override |
| public int getIcon(AccessPoint ap) { |
| int level = ap.getLevel(); |
| return ICONS[level >= 0 ? level : 0]; |
| } |
| |
| public boolean connect(AccessPoint ap) { |
| if (ap == null) return false; |
| if (DEBUG) Log.d(TAG, "connect networkId=" + ap.getConfig().networkId); |
| if (ap.isSaved()) { |
| mWifiTracker.getManager().connect(ap.getConfig().networkId, mConnectListener); |
| } else { |
| // Unknown network, need to add it. |
| if (ap.getSecurity() != AccessPoint.SECURITY_NONE) { |
| Intent intent = new Intent(Settings.ACTION_WIFI_SETTINGS); |
| intent.putExtra(EXTRA_START_CONNECT_SSID, ap.getSsidStr()); |
| intent.addFlags(Intent.FLAG_ACTIVITY_NEW_TASK); |
| fireSettingsIntentCallback(intent); |
| return true; |
| } else { |
| ap.generateOpenNetworkConfig(); |
| mWifiTracker.getManager().connect(ap.getConfig(), mConnectListener); |
| } |
| } |
| return false; |
| } |
| |
| private void fireSettingsIntentCallback(Intent intent) { |
| for (AccessPointCallback callback : mCallbacks) { |
| callback.onSettingsActivityTriggered(intent); |
| } |
| } |
| |
| private void fireAcccessPointsCallback(List<AccessPoint> aps) { |
| for (AccessPointCallback callback : mCallbacks) { |
| callback.onAccessPointsChanged(aps); |
| } |
| } |
| |
| public void dump(PrintWriter pw) { |
| mWifiTracker.dump(pw); |
| } |
| |
| @Override |
| public void onWifiStateChanged(int state) { |
| } |
| |
| @Override |
| public void onConnectedChanged() { |
| fireAcccessPointsCallback(mWifiTracker.getAccessPoints()); |
| } |
| |
| @Override |
| public void onAccessPointsChanged() { |
| fireAcccessPointsCallback(mWifiTracker.getAccessPoints()); |
| } |
| |
| private final ActionListener mConnectListener = new ActionListener() { |
| @Override |
| public void onSuccess() { |
| if (DEBUG) Log.d(TAG, "connect success"); |
| } |
| |
| @Override |
| public void onFailure(int reason) { |
| if (DEBUG) Log.d(TAG, "connect failure reason=" + reason); |
| } |
| }; |
| } |
